Town Hall
Town Hall
The Town Hall is located in a large square-shaped tower, which was built by the islanders in the 15th century. It was originally located within the town walls, and on the ground floor there were the city gates. The Town Hall is decorated with the coats of arms of doge Augustin Barbariga, which testifies to the strong influence of the Venetian government, and the most standout decoration is an unusual clock set on the eastern side of the building. The clock was first mentioned in 1538, but unlike the usual clocks, this has 24 fields.
